Here's What Medicare Part B Costs and Covers in 2021

Nearly every American 65 or older turns to Medicare for help to pay for healthcare. Traditional Medicare relies on two components: Part A coverage for hospital and inpatient care, and Part B coverage for doctor visits and outpatient treatment.

Every year, changes to Medicare affect those who rely on the program for their financial security during their retirement years. Let's take a closer look at the latest for Part B in 2021.

Medicare Part B covers most care for which you do not need to be admitted to a hospital or other treatment facility. That includes routine doctor visits as well as outpatient surgery. You'll also turn to Part B for a host of needs ranging from medical equipment and ambulance transportation to diagnostic testing and treatment for mental health issues.
